When purchasing waterfront properties in East Palo Alto, prioritize inspections for water damage and foundation integrity. Verify flood zone designations and insurance requirements carefully. Consider seasonal water levels and environmental conditions. Review HOA regulations if applicable. Work with agents experienced in San Mateo County waterfront transactions. Evaluate accessibility and parking on bayfront lots. Request utility information and environmental reports. Schedule inspections during various weather conditions to assess property performance.
Maximize waterfront property value by highlighting panoramic bay views through professional photography and virtual tours. Emphasize outdoor living spaces, decks, and entertainment areas. Ensure landscape maintenance showcases water access benefits. Document recent upgrades and sustainability features. Obtain updated environmental reports and flood insurance information proactively. Price competitively using recent comparable sales data. Market extensively to Silicon Valley professionals seeking premium lifestyle properties. Consider seasonal timing for optimal buyer exposure.
